Output d8c3886c1f705f64ea16360a7557a9426a4ee6c74710d78d6dfc9b18f5029694:0

value
284247
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d095301036e124abfd3a5fad410bb95cfef993a OP_EQUALVERIFY OP_CHECKSIG
address
1DrjSucxRG11cQsvmaUNusFA1qSx9t5gxC
transaction
d8c3886c1f705f64ea16360a7557a9426a4ee6c74710d78d6dfc9b18f5029694
spent
true